# tailwart
> Tailscale × Stalwart. A mailbox with no WAN presence, fronted by a layer-4
> proxy that can live on another machine entirely.
A deliberately over-engineered playground: [Stalwart](https://github.com/stalwartlabs/stalwart)
mail server wired into **Postgres + Redis + Garage S3** at once, deployed as a
Tailscale sidecar, with a separate `caddy-l4` edge that pipes the raw mail ports
over the tailnet. For `infinidim.net`.
See [CLAUDE.md](./CLAUDE.md) for the architecture and the gotchas, and
[LESSONS.md](./LESSONS.md) for the hard-won symptom→cause→fix notes from
bringing it up (PG races, ACME DNS-01, PROXY-protocol trust, IPv6 egress, …).

> **v0.16 config model:** `config.json` describes *only* where Postgres lives;
> everything else (domains, accounts, listeners, ACME, blob/Redis wiring, proxy
> trust, DKIM, spam) lives **in Postgres**, managed via the web UI or JMAP. The
> old TOML + `%{env}%` macro model is gone — see CLAUDE.md / LESSONS.md.

`provision-stalwart.sh` replaces the setup wizard: it writes config straight into
Postgres via the `x:` JMAP API. **Tier 1** (default) configures everything and
*prints* the DNS records for you to publish; **tier 2** (set `STALWART_DNS_API_KEY`)
lets Stalwart auto-publish DNS + run ACME DNS-01. See the comments in `.env.example`.
Then point `infinidim.net`'s MX at the edge host (or let tier-2 publish it) and
finish any opinionated bits (spam tuning, retention) in the web admin.
## Status
Live. Pinned to `stalwartlabs/stalwart:v0.16.7`, booting cleanly against the
shared Postgres/Redis/Garage backends, holding a Let's Encrypt wildcard via
ACME DNS-01 (Spaceship), and relaying outbound over the tailnet (the VPS blocks
all outbound SMTP ports). The container has its own IPv6 egress.
Not yet exposed for inbound IPv6 mail: `mail.infinidim.net` is intentionally
A-only until the edge proxy gains v6 `:25` listeners — publish its `AAAA` and
the v6 listeners together, or senders will try v6 and some won't fall back. See
LESSONS.md.
